Scallop Size Chart
Scallop Size Chart - Basically, this number tells you how big the scallops are, and how many you can expect to get per pound. The smaller this number range is, the larger (by weight) the scallops are. Packages of fresh or frozen sea scallops labeled as u/8, u/10, u/12, or u/15 are the largest.
